#23b4d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23b4dd is composed of 13.7% red, 70.6%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 193.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 50.2%. #23b4dd color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#0069bb.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#23b4d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23b4dd has RGB values of R:35, G:180,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 2340061.

Shades and Tints of #23b4d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#23b4d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8385 is the less saturated color, while #06c4fa is the most saturated one.
